Prove that sin20 sin40 sin60 sin80=3/16

sin 20° · sin 40° · sin 80° = 1/2 ( cos 20° - cos 60° ) · sin 80° =
= 1/2 ( cos 20° sin 80° - cos 60° sin 80° ) =
= 1/2 ( (sin 100° + sin 60°)/2 - 1/2 sin 80° )=            ( sin 100° = sin 80° )
= 1/2 · ( 1/2 sin 60° ) = 1/4 sin 60° = √3 / 8
sin 60° = √ 3/2
√ 3 / 2 · √ 3 / 8 = 3/16  ( correct )
